Our purpose

Turning shared expertise into stronger glaucoma care.

The Glaucoma Society of Nigeria brings together ophthalmologists and eye-care professionals with a special interest in glaucoma. We foster professional exchange, public education, research and partnerships that can improve prevention of avoidable vision loss.

We believe progress comes from listening to patients, strengthening clinical capability, sharing evidence and working with institutions across every level of the health system.

National leadership

Meet the executive council.

The society is guided by experienced Nigerian ophthalmologists who serve its members and mission.

Portrait of Prof. Olusola Olawoye

Prof. Olusola Olawoye

Chairman

Portrait of Prof. Elizabeth Awoyesuku

Prof. Elizabeth Awoyesuku

Vice Chairman

Portrait of Prof. Chimdia Ogbonnaya

Prof. Chimdia Ogbonnaya

Secretary

Portrait of Dr. Adedeji Akinyemi

Dr. Adedeji Akinyemi

Financial Secretary

Portrait of Prof. Regina Morgan

Prof. Regina Morgan

Treasurer

Portrait of Dr. Tokunbo Obajolowo

Dr. Tokunbo Obajolowo

Public Relations Officer

Portrait of Prof. Fatima Kyari

Prof. Fatima Kyari

Ex Officio
